Discover the Truth: Can Removing Ear Wax Stop Tinnitus?

Tinnitus, the frustrating sensation of ringing or buzzing in the ears, affects millions of people worldwide. Many individuals wonder if removing ear wax can actually help alleviate this bothersome condition. The truth is, there is a potential link between ear wax buildup and tinnitus. When excess earwax accumulates in the ear canal, it can cause blockages that interfere with sound conduction and lead to symptoms of tinnitus. In some cases, simply removing this buildup of ear wax can provide relief from tinnitus symptoms.

Some may question whether ear wax removal alone can completely stop tinnitus. While it may not be a cure-all for every case of tinnitus, addressing any blockages caused by excess ear wax can certainly help reduce the severity of symptoms. For a comprehensive approach to managing tinnitus, it is important to consider other factors that may contribute to the condition, such as hearing loss, stress, or underlying medical issues. By combining ear wax removal with other strategies for tinnitus management, individuals may experience greater relief and improved overall well-being.

It is important to note that individual experiences with tinnitus can vary, and what works for one person may not work for another. However, taking steps to address potential factors like ear wax buildup can be a positive step towards managing tinnitus symptoms. By seeking professional guidance from healthcare providers, individuals can explore various treatment options and find a personalized approach that works best for them.
